当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储oss提供那种接口协议是什么类型的文件,深入解析对象存储OSS支持的接口协议类型及其应用场景

对象存储oss提供那种接口协议是什么类型的文件,深入解析对象存储OSS支持的接口协议类型及其应用场景

对象存储OSS支持HTTP/HTTPS协议,用于文件上传、下载和操作。HTTP/HTTPS协议适用于各种场景,如网站文件托管、云存储服务等。深入解析发现,OSS还支持A...

对象存储OSS支持HTTP/HTTPS协议,用于文件上传、下载和操作。HTTP/HTTPS协议适用于各种场景,如网站文件托管、云存储服务等。深入解析发现,OSS还支持API接口,如RESTful API,适用于应用程序集成,提供灵活的文件管理功能。

随着互联网技术的飞速发展,数据存储需求日益增长,对象存储(Object Storage)作为一种高效、安全、可扩展的存储方式,逐渐成为云计算领域的重要分支,对象存储系统(如阿里云OSS、腾讯云COS等)为用户提供丰富的接口协议,以满足不同场景下的存储需求,本文将深入解析对象存储OSS支持的接口协议类型及其应用场景。

对象存储OSS支持的接口协议类型

1、RESTful API

RESTful API是一种基于HTTP协议的接口规范,广泛应用于Web服务中,对象存储OSS也提供了RESTful API,用户可以通过HTTP请求进行对象的上传、下载、删除等操作,RESTful API具有以下特点:

(1)简单易用:基于HTTP协议,易于学习和使用。

(2)可扩展性强:支持自定义域名,方便进行访问控制。

对象存储oss提供那种接口协议是什么类型的文件,深入解析对象存储OSS支持的接口协议类型及其应用场景

(3)跨平台:支持多种编程语言和操作系统。

2、SDK

SDK(软件开发工具包)是针对特定平台和编程语言提供的接口封装,用户可以通过SDK简化编程工作,对象存储OSS提供了多种SDK,包括Java、Python、PHP、C++、Go等,以下是部分SDK的特点:

(1)简化编程:封装底层操作,降低开发难度。

(2)性能优化:针对特定语言进行优化,提高程序运行效率。

(3)丰富功能:提供对象存储、文件存储、大数据等功能。

3、命令行工具

命令行工具是一种基于文本的接口,用户可以通过命令行执行操作,对象存储OSS提供了命令行工具,如ossutil,支持Windows、Linux、Mac OS等操作系统,以下是命令行工具的特点:

(1)灵活性强:支持自定义脚本,实现自动化操作。

(2)方便监控:可以通过日志查看操作记录。

对象存储oss提供那种接口协议是什么类型的文件,深入解析对象存储OSS支持的接口协议类型及其应用场景

(3)跨平台:支持多种操作系统。

4、网关接口

网关接口是一种在用户和存储系统之间搭建的桥梁,用户可以通过网关接口访问存储系统,对象存储OSS提供了网关接口,支持NFS、CIFS等协议,方便用户在现有存储环境中使用OSS服务,以下是网关接口的特点:

(1)兼容性强:支持多种协议,方便用户迁移。

(2)简化配置:无需修改现有存储环境,降低迁移成本。

(3)易于扩展:支持自定义配置,满足个性化需求。

接口协议应用场景

1、RESTful API

(1)Web应用:RESTful API可以方便地与Web应用集成,实现图片、视频等文件的存储和访问。

(2)移动应用:RESTful API支持移动应用访问对象存储,实现离线数据同步、文件上传下载等功能。

2、SDK

对象存储oss提供那种接口协议是什么类型的文件,深入解析对象存储OSS支持的接口协议类型及其应用场景

(1)大数据应用:SDK可以方便地与大数据框架集成,实现海量数据的存储和计算。

(2)云应用:SDK支持云应用开发,简化编程工作,提高开发效率。

3、命令行工具

(1)自动化操作:命令行工具可以编写脚本,实现自动化操作,如定时备份、清理等。

(2)监控管理:通过命令行工具,可以方便地监控存储系统运行状态,及时发现和处理问题。

4、网关接口

(1)传统存储迁移:网关接口支持NFS、CIFS等协议,方便用户将传统存储系统迁移至对象存储。

(2)异构存储融合:网关接口可以与多种存储系统融合,实现数据共享和访问。

对象存储OSS提供了多种接口协议,包括RESTful API、SDK、命令行工具和网关接口等,满足不同场景下的存储需求,用户可以根据自身需求选择合适的接口协议,实现高效、安全的存储服务,随着云计算技术的不断发展,对象存储在各个领域中的应用将越来越广泛。

黑狐家游戏

发表评论

最新文章